What should I pay attention to when exercising in hot weather?

The temperature is high in summer, so you exercise in a high temperature environment. Because the ambient temperature is higher than the skin temperature, the heat generated by the body cannot be quickly dissipated, but it will absorb the surrounding heat, so it is easy to get heatstroke. Exercise in high temperature environment will reduce the ability of cardiovascular system to transport oxygen due to a lot of sweating, rapid dehydration, electrolyte loss and disorder of body fluid balance. Exercise in a hot environment, the skin needs a lot of blood supply to maintain heat dissipation in the body, which also greatly affects the blood supply of muscles and makes the energy supply of muscles insufficient. In addition, the heat in the body can not be well distributed, and nervous system disorders will occur when the body temperature is too high, such as headache, nausea, vomiting and dizziness. By the way, when the body temperature reaches 43℃, people will die because of the extensive degeneration of metabolic enzymes in the body.

Although the temperature is high in summer, it is not impossible to exercise. Pay attention to the following questions when exercising:

A. reduce the intensity of exercise and let the body gradually form thermal adaptation.

B. Avoid noon (11:00 ~15: 00), preferably before 10 and after 3 pm.

C. Avoid exercising in direct sunlight to prevent skin sunburn and heatstroke.

D resting intermittently in the shade during exercise and supplementing vitamin c in moderation can improve the body's heat adaptability.

E. When exercising, you should replenish water and electrolyte in small amounts for many times, and don't drink a lot of water at one time. This will easily increase the burden on the heart and accelerate the loss of electrolytes and cramps.

F. Don't take a cold bath immediately after exercise.
